hej chlopi hladam na internete ale tam su len zakladne odcitania, nenasiel niekto niekde lepsie nech kuknem lebo niesom si v odcitani na 100 percent isty dik
Ak chces odcitat dve cisla v binarnej sustave tak to mozes spravit aj takto. Cislo, ktore chces odcitat doplnis na rovnaky pocet miest spredu nulami (ak by nemali rovnaky pocet miest) potom ho bit po bite znegujes a pripocitas k nemu 1. To co ti vyjde pripocitas k tomu cislu od ktoreho si chcel odcitat a pri vysledku zanedbas prvu jednotku.
Skusim to znazornit dajme tomu ze chces od 11011 odcitat 111 (11011 - 111) takze:
1. 111 doplnim spredu nulami na rovnaky pocet miest cize to bude 00111
2. teraz to bit po bite znegujem teda dostanem 11000 a priratam 1. Dostanem 11001
3. 11001 pripocitam k tomu cislu od ktoreho odcitavam, cize 11011 + 11001 z coho mi vyjde 110100 ale zanedbam prvu jednotku takze vysledok je 10100.
Mne osobne sa tento sposob paci, zda sa mi menej nachylny na chyby. Ale mozes odcitavam klasicky ako v desiatkovej sustave.